Thames Water is currently seeking a skilled and driven Senior Data Analyst to join our team. In this pivotal role, you will support client managers by delivering expert insight and guidance across a broad range of business areas, from day-to-day operations to high-impact projects.

What you will be doing as the Senior Data Analyst: You’ll be responsible for extracting, transforming and loading (ETL) data, as well as organising, visualising, analysing and presenting insights in a clear and compelling manner. A key aspect of this role will involve contributing to the successful migration of data from legacy on-premise systems to the Azure Cloud. This position supports all Customer Service,

Financial Customer Care and Wholesale units, as well as wider organisational reporting needs across Thames Water.

Data is the fuel of the digital economy, and turning raw records into reliable, analysis-ready information is the job of the data engineer. From building lake-house architectures to orchestrating near-real-time pipelines, demand for these skills is soaring across finance, retail, health-tech and government. The UK boasts several universities recognised internationally for large-scale data systems and scalable computing.
